A ball falls off a table and reaches the ground in 1s. Assuming `g=10m//s^(2)`, calculate its speed on reaching the ground and the height of the table.

Given: Time `(t)=1s`
Gravitational acceleration `(g)=10m//s^(2)`
Initial velocity `(u)=0m//s`
To fid: Final velocity `(v)=?`
Displacement `(s)=?`
Formulae `v=u+"gt",s=ut+1/2"gt"^(2)`
Solution `:v=u+"gt"`
`=0+10xx1`
`v=10m//s`
`s=0+1/2xx10xx1^(2)`
`s=5m`
Speed on reaching ground is 10m//s and height of the table is 5m.
